Output 91fc62296d01aeaa64ef2566af2985124585f33f17fba0578248d7311f1c05e2:3

value
21378
script pubkey
OP_0 OP_PUSHBYTES_20 e37c5532b212f6b371c1ba3d6c13dc96aa0baf02
address
bc1qud792v4jztmtxuwphg7kcy7uj64qhtcznj78ja
transaction
91fc62296d01aeaa64ef2566af2985124585f33f17fba0578248d7311f1c05e2
spent
true